Recruitment campaigns are underway to find Head Teachers for three East Lothian schools.

New leaders are sought for Musselburgh Grammar School, North Berwick High School and West Barns Primary School. The adverts went live on the online portal myjobscotland.gov.uk on Friday 12 February. The closing date for the posts is 28 February 2021.

Cabinet member for Education and Children’s Services Councillor Shamin Akhtar said: “These are exciting opportunities for any Head Teacher considering a new challenge, or for a school leader looking to progress their career with a move into Headship.

“Our Head Teachers are well supported in their roles by the Education team, their colleagues in other schools, and by active and vibrant parent communities.

"We’re looking for dynamic individuals with the background, skills and confidence to build on the good work of their predecessors and inspire their teams to drive forward excellence, attainment and school improvement.”

Musselburgh Grammar Head Teacher Colin Gerrie is set to leave the school at the end of the school session in June 2021 to pursue a new position as Head of Greenfield International School, Dubai, while Lauren Rodger, Head Teacher at North Berwick High School will retire at the end of session, June 2021. Laura Hay, who has been acting Head Teacher at West Barns Primary School was recently appointed to the position of Depute Head Teacher at Dunbar Primary, leading to the vacancy at West Barns.

Councillor Ahktar added: “We will work closely with the schools’ Parent Councils throughout the recruitment process and look forward to updating the wider communities in due course.”
